1. Key Highlights of RRB NTPC 2025
- Recruiting Body: Railway Recruitment Board (RRB)
- Number of Vacancies: 30,307
- Post Categories: Non-Technical Popular Categories (NTPC)
- Educational Qualification: Graduation from a recognized university
- Age Limit: 18–36 years (with relaxation for reserved categories)
- Application Start Date: 30 August 2025
- Application Last Date: 29 September 2025
- Official Website: www.indianrailways.gov.in
2. Vacancy Details

The recruitment covers various administrative and operational posts:
Post Name | Vacancies | Approximate Monthly Salary |
Chief Commercial & Ticket Supervisor | 6,235 | ₹35,400 |
Station Master | 5,623 | ₹35,400 |
Goods Train Manager | 3,562 | ₹29,200 |
Junior Account Assistant & Typist | 7,520 | ₹29,200 |
Senior Clerk & Typist | 7,367 | ₹29,200 |
These salaries come with additional benefits like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), and medical facilities for the employee and their family.
3. Eligibility Criteria
To apply, candidates must:
- Hold a graduation degree from a recognized university.
- Be aged between 18 and 36 years as of the notification date (age relaxation as per government rules).
- Meet medical standards required for the post applied.
4. Selection Process
The RRB NTPC selection involves:
- Computer-Based Test (CBT) – Tests candidates on General Awareness, Mathematics, General Intelligence, and Reasoning.
- Interview – Shortlisted candidates are called for an interview.
- Document Verification – Educational and identity documents are checked.
- Medical Examination – Final health check before appointment.

8. Step-by-Step Guide to Apply
- Visit www.indianrailways.gov.in.
- Navigate to the RRB NTPC Recruitment 2025 section.
- Download and read the official notification carefully.
- Click on the “Apply Online” link for your RRB zone.
- Fill in the form with correct details.
- Upload the required documents (photo, signature, certificates).
- Pay the application fee (if applicable).
- Submit the form and take a printout for future use.
9. Preparation Tips for Kannada Candidates
- General Awareness: Read newspapers and keep track of Karnataka-specific developments.
- Mathematics: Practice basic arithmetic, percentages, ratios, and data interpretation.
- Reasoning: Solve puzzles and logical reasoning questions daily.
- Language Skills: Brush up on English and Kannada comprehension for better performance.
